Non-Opioid Analgesics
Non-opioid analgesics are typically the first-line treatment for moderate to moderate pain. 2. NSAIDs
NSAIDs work by inhibiting enzymes associated with the production of prostaglandins, substances that moderate pain and inflammation. While reliable, extended usage can lead to gastrointestinal problems, cardiovascular risks, and kidney issues.
3. Opioid Analgesics
Opioids are effective painkiller suggested for moderate to severe pain, particularly in cases of injury, surgery, or cancer. These drugs work by binding to specific receptors in the brain and spine to block pain signals. Nevertheless, their use is connected with extreme side impacts, consisting of the risk of addiction, respiratory depression, and constipation.
4. Adjuvant Analgesics
Adjuvant analgesics do not mainly act as pain relievers however can improve pain relief when combined with other medications. Antidepressants such as amitriptyline and anticonvulsants like gabapentin work for neuropathic pain conditions.
5. Topical Analgesics
Topical analgesics are applied directly to the skin to supply localized pain relief. These include lidocaine spots and capsaicin creams, which can help minimize pain without the systemic side impacts connected with oral medications.
Mechanism of Action
Understanding how pain relief drugs work is important for their efficient usage. Below is a summary of the systems behind the numerous types of analgesics:

Non-Opioid Analgesics: Inhibit the enzyme cyclooxygenase (COX), lowering the formation of prostaglandins, which in turn reduces pain and inflammation.

NSAIDs: Similar to non-opioid analgesics, however with a more pronounced effect on swelling through COX inhibition.

Opioid Analgesics: Bind to opioid receptors in the brain, spine, and other areas, altering the understanding and psychological action to pain.

Adjuvant Analgesics: Modulate nerve activity and neurotransmitter release, resulting in reduced pain understanding, specifically in persistent pain conditions.

What should I consider when selecting a pain relief drug?
When choosing a pain relief medication, consider aspects such as the type and seriousness of pain, your medical history, possible negative effects, and any other medications you might be taking. Always seek advice from a healthcare professional before beginning or altering a pain management routine.

4. How can I manage persistent pain efficiently?
Effective chronic pain management often requires a multidisciplinary method, consisting of medication, physical treatment, mental support, and lifestyle modifications. Working carefully with health care experts can assist tailor an appropriate strategy.
5. What are the threats of long-lasting use of pain relief medications?
Long-term usage of pain relief medications, especially opioids and NSAIDs, can result in significant health problems such as reliance, tolerance, and organ damage. Routine tracking by a health care expert is crucial.
